Maple Bar is a cooked dish. It is prepared using either the kitchen inside an upgraded farmhouse or a Cookout Kit. It can be purchased from Sam's shop at the Desert Festival for 20 Calico Eggs. One Maple Bar may be received from opening a Mystery Box. It may rotate into stock at the Traveling Cart and is sold for 900–1,500g.

Maple Bar Effects

Eating Maple Bar restores 225 energy and 101 health.

BuffLasts 16m 48s
  • +1 Farming
  • +1 Fishing
  • +1 Mining

Maple Bar Cheat Help

Item spawning in Stardew Valley isn't accomplished through typical commands. Instead, it involves a cheat method where you name your character, or an animal, with the item code of the desired item, enclosed in square brackets [ and ]. Include the brackets when naming.

Spawn Using Animal Name

To spawn this item, buy an animal (we recommend a chicken because it is the cheapest) from Marnie's Ranch, name it [731]. You will then receive the Maple Bar item.

Spawn Using Character Name

Since you can only set your character's name once at the game's inception, we advise using the animal naming method.

However, if you opt for this method, name your character [731] while creating your save file. When you converse with any villager who mentions your name in their dialogue, like Gus at the Stardrop Saloon, you'll receive the Maple Bar item.
